Overview
Learn to build RESTful web services in Java using Jersey and Spring in this comprehensive tutorial. Explore REST API fundamentals, create Jersey projects in Eclipse, implement resource classes, work with JSON and XML, integrate MySQL databases, and handle HTTP methods. Gain hands-on experience with Postman for API testing, and dive into Spring Boot and Spring JPA for building robust REST applications. Master essential concepts and practical techniques for developing scalable and efficient web services.
